What is a 13amp outlet?

If you have a dual fuel range cooker (also known as an electric and gas oven), then you'll need an appropriate 13 amp plug. The plug also needs to be wired hard into the cooker circuit using a qualified electrician.

This ensures that the current flowing through the plug is safe and not too high, which could create an electrical fire risk. The plug is equipped with a fuse that controls the current. The fuse blows whenever the current passes through it beyond its capacity, which protects the appliance from overload of electricity.

The fuse is rated at 13 amps, as indicated on the top of the plug. This is the maximum amount of current that the plug can pass without damaging the appliance or heating the socket. It is crucial that when replacing fuses, you always use the same rated amps as the original. If you replace the fuse with one that has the different ratings, you are at risk of overheating the socket and placing yourself and others at high risk.

Ceramic 13 amp fuses are very robust and are able to withstand extreme temperatures from an oven. Ceramic is also fire-proof, which makes it a better option than other kinds of fuse.

How do I install an outlet with 13amps?

The vast majority of dual fuel range cookers in the UK are connected to a 13 amp plug socket and this is very important since ovens draw a considerable amount of current, and standard plug sockets are designed to handle 10 amps.

Generally speaking new appliances should be fitted with a plug at the point of sale. This is part of ensuring compliance with the Plugs and Sockets etc (Safety) Regulations 1994. However, older appliances may not be connected to a plug and this is the reason why the problem occurs.

When connecting the cooker to an existing plug socket the first thing to do is to make sure that the rating of the fuse inside the fuse box matches the plug's rating. This is vital because an incorrectly-sized fuse can be dangerous.

It is also important to make sure that the fuse is set within the cartridge and that there is no excessive movement within it. The next step is to prepare the flex to be used. Take off the sheathing and reveal the three conductors that are insulated. Use a utility blade to cut the sheathing beyond the cord grip at the entry point of the plug. This will not be able to penetrate the insulated conductors. The nick should be large enough that the sheathing can split and expand the nick as it is pulled back, revealing the cable beneath. Cut off the excess sheathing, leaving around 40mm beyond the flex.

The flex is then positioned over the plug and the earth terminal is placed at the top, and the live and neutral terminals at the bottom. Using the conductors with the colors to guide you to the right direction, the sheathing should be removed from each pin and the internal cable is inserted into the appropriate terminal using the cord grip. If the plug is equipped with a clamp for cords that is screw-type, let it loosen and then pull the insulation back to expose the copper wires. Connect each of the conductors insulated to the appropriate terminal (starting with the earth before neutral, and then the live) using the channel they are running through the plug.

What is the most draw for an appliance switch?

There is a lot confusion regarding the maximum current draw of the cooker switch. Most cookers are hard-wired and connected to a dedicated oven-ring circuit and not the standard socket. This is due to the fact that they usually consume more than 20 amps when the gas hob and electric oven are used.

You will not find dual fuel range cookers that can be fitted in a standard socket, because this could create an extremely high risk of fire and would violate electrical regulations. A licensed electrician must always install new electrical wiring in the kitchen, connecting them to an oven. They should also ensure that the total load of the oven and the hob does not exceed the circuit's supply capacity.
